How they compare

India currently reports 9.28 million t against 680,887 t in Thailand, a difference of 8.60 million t.

That makes India's figure about 13.6 times Thailand's.

Across all 13 years both countries report, India has been ahead every year.

India ranks 1st and Thailand ranks 4th of 102 countries.

India has averaged higher in every one of the 3 decades both report.

Head to head by decade

Decade India Thailand Difference Ahead
2000s 7.46 million t 299,130 t 7.16 million t India
2010s 10.06 million t 264,563 t 9.79 million t India
2020s 10.60 million t 845,506 t 9.76 million t India

Averages of every year both report within each decade.

The Fertilizers by Product dataset contains information on the Production, Trade and Agriculture Use of inorganic (chemical or mineral) fertilizers products. The fertilizer statistics data are for a set of 23 product categories. Both straight and compound fertilizers are included.
